£45,000 - £47,000 Basic + Bonuses + Overtime (OTE £70K+) + Vehicle + Training + Technical Progression + Door to Door Pay + Enhanced Pension + Package
Location: South East
We offer a fantastic and rare opportunity to join a world-leading OEM renowned for the quality of their products and the level of service they provide. Are you an electrical or mechanical biased engineer with experience in power generation machinery, or a strong engineering background looking to increase your knowledge and skill set?
This role allows you to become a true technical specialist in a critical engineering environment, working with the latest power generation technologies. Earn a competitive package while receiving official OEM training and progressing into more senior positions. The company is heavily involved in the UK's transition to a net-zero economy and has a diverse client portfolio within critical power generation infrastructure.
This manufacturer has a global presence across industries such as Power Generation, Marine, Rail, Aviation, and Nuclear. The division specializes in power generation to provide low-carbon solutions for client infrastructure. They prioritize staff development and internal progression.
Key Responsibilities:
* Service, maintenance, breakdowns, and commissioning
* Working on CHP’s, GAS Engines, UPS, and renewable energy systems
* Electrical & Mechanical fault finding and repairs (UPS, ComAp, three-phase systems, drives, motors, PLCs, engines)
* Customer-facing role, Monday to Friday, covering the surrounding territory
* Experience working with 450KW+ systems
* Familiarity with CHP, Diesel or Gas Engines, Generators, UPS, Industrial Plant, or similar
* Experience as a Service Engineer, Maintenance Engineer, or Marine Engineer
* Electrical or Mechanical qualifications or equivalent (NVQ, HNC, etc.)
